Hadong in Gyeongnam, with its beautiful scenery of Pyeongsa-ri fields and the leisurely flowing Seomjingang River!

Austin, an American who loves Korean food more than Koreans, goes on a gastronomic trip to Hadong, full of spring, with his friend Johnny Kyung-ho.

Two people heading to the port of Seomjingang River to enjoy the ‘cherry caves’ of Seomjingang River, the harbinger of spring!

It is said that oysters caught from rivers rather than the sea are characterized by a savory, not salty taste. What does the ‘Cherry Oyster Samhap’, which is made with pickled plums and kimchi on top of oysters, taste like?

Austin is a place you must visit when you come to Hadong. That place is the country house where Austin’s old friend ‘Hongtae’ lives.

For Hongtae, who welcomes him with open arms every time he comes, Mr. Austin personally digs up spring vegetables, seasoned wild chives, boils shepherd’s purse and soybean paste stew, and even prepares firewood-grilled pork belly!

Mr. Austin, who is sincere about the ‘home-made taste’ of Korea, is full of delicious Hadong meals.

The next day, Austin and Johnny Kyung-ho head to Sangseonam, where plum blossoms are in full bloom in green tea fields. The two experience Korea’s spring with the fragrant flower tea of ​​Monk Boseong, who lives at Sangseonam Temple.
